Dungeon Hunter Alliance is the closest I have yet to find. It plays smooth, loads mostly fast, and has an easy to slide into control pattern.
Not everything is great in this game, however. The story is a little thin, there is no character customization and the leveling system is very, VERY basic. The lack of a controllable camera angle or zoom level is saddening, since the right analog stick does nothing really, (at least, not yet for the character I am playing). This is unfortunate because your characters appearance changes with different weapons and armor, but most of which you barely see because the camera is zoomed out.
I have not yet had a chance to play this game with friends or online, but the option to pick up a second controller and drop in is always there.
This is a solid game for someone looking for a decent action RGP with gratifying kills and plenty of loot. Anyone who was addicted to CoN and RTA as I was once will likely appreciate having this affordable option if they don't want to track down a PS2 and buy those old games off of ebay.
